How Mcppsh.com Operates
Trojan-type threats, such as Mcppsh.com, typically operate by exploiting system vulnerabilities or using social engineering tactics to gain unauthorized access to a computer. Once inside, they can create backdoors, allowing attackers to remotely control the system, steal sensitive information, or install additional malware. These threats can also modify system settings, disable security software, and disrupt system performance. How to Remove Mcppsh.com
- Boot your system in Safe Mode with Networking to prevent the malware from loading and to allow for internet access. This will enable you to download and install removal tools.
- Perform a full scan of your system using a reputable anti-malware tool, such as SpyHunter, to detect and remove all instances of Mcppsh.com and related malware.
- Uninstall any suspicious programs or applications that may be associated with the infection. Be cautious when removing programs, as some may be legitimate or required by your system.
- Reset your web browsers, including Chrome, Firefox, and Edge, to their default settings to remove any malicious extensions or add-ons that may be related to the infection.
- Reboot your system and perform another full scan to ensure that all remnants of the malware have been removed. This step is crucial in verifying that the removal process was successful and that your system is clean.
